F1 TV Pro vs. F1 TV Access
First off, it's important to understand the two main tiers of F1 TV: F1 TV Pro and F1 TV Access. F1 TV Pro is the premium tier that includes live race streaming, while F1 TV Access offers live timing data, race replays, and highlights, but not live races. So, if your goal is to watch the races as they happen, F1 TV Pro is the way to go. This is where the excitement truly lives, giving you a front-row seat to every Grand Prix.
Location, Location, Location
Here’s where things get a bit tricky. The availability of live streaming on F1 TV Pro is subject to regional restrictions. Due to broadcasting agreements, some countries do not allow live streaming of F1 races on F1 TV. This means that even with an F1 TV Pro subscription, you might not be able to watch live races in certain locations. What You Get with F1 TV Pro
Okay, let’s assume you're in a region where F1 TV Pro does offer live streaming. What exactly do you get? Well, buckle up because it's a lot! You get access to all Formula 1 sessions live, including practice sessions, qualifying, and the race itself. But that's not all! You also get access to live timing data, driver tracker maps, and onboard cameras. This means you can follow your favorite drivers from their perspective, getting a true feel for the track and the challenges they face. It's like being in the cockpit with them, experiencing every twist and turn.
Moreover, F1 TV Pro often includes pre-race and post-race shows, giving you expert analysis and insights. You can also access a vast archive of past races, reliving some of the most iconic moments in Formula 1 history. It's a treasure trove for any F1 enthusiast.
What If Live Streaming Isn't Available in Your Region?
So, what if you're in a region where live streaming isn't available? Don't worry; you still have options! F1 TV Access provides access to race replays shortly after the race, usually within a couple of days. While it's not the same as watching live, it's a great way to catch up on the action and avoid spoilers. Plus, you still get access to live timing data and highlights, keeping you in the loop.
Another option is to explore other streaming services or TV channels that have broadcasting rights for Formula 1 in your region. Many sports streaming platforms offer live F1 coverage, so it's worth checking what's available in your area. Just remember to do your research and choose a reputable provider.

Tips for a Smooth Streaming Experience
Once you've confirmed that F1 TV Pro offers live streaming in your region, here are a few tips to ensure a smooth and enjoyable viewing experience:
- Ensure you have a stable internet connection: Live streaming requires a reliable internet connection, so make sure you have a strong Wi-Fi signal or a stable wired connection. There's nothing worse than buffering during a crucial moment in the race.
- Use a compatible device: F1 TV is compatible with a wide range of devices, including computers, smartphones, tablets, and streaming devices like Roku and Apple TV. Make sure your device meets the minimum system requirements for optimal performance.
- Update your app: Keep your F1 TV app updated to the latest version to ensure you have access to the latest features and bug fixes. App updates often include performance improvements that can enhance your viewing experience.
- Adjust your streaming quality: If you're experiencing buffering or lag, try lowering the streaming quality. While you won't get the same level of detail, it can help ensure a smoother viewing experience. You can usually adjust the streaming quality in the F1 TV app settings.
- Close unnecessary apps: Close any unnecessary apps or programs running in the background to free up system resources and improve streaming performance. This can be especially helpful if you're using an older device.
